Kontext: „movement“
(verb) to move from one place to another. When you walk, run, drive, or fly somewhere, you go to that place.
Beispiel
She goes to school every morning.
Beispiel
He doesn't go to the park on weekends.
Beispiel
Where does she go after work?
Kontext: „action or state“
(verb) to happen or occur in a specific way or to be in a particular state. It's about things that occur or the way something is.
Beispiel
The party goes until midnight.
Beispiel
The plan didn't go as expected.
Beispiel
How did the meeting go with your boss?
